表单设计与实施过程

  • 1 关于多选表单实施过程(总结)

  环境:用户表-组表-用户组关联表
  产品对象:全国各个省,市,区县 大学以及医院
  需求:省看到所有医院  医院看到该医院所有信息
  关联表设计 用户id,组id 机构id 地区id
  设计思路:不同地区,机构 根据不同id 看到所应信息
 
  问题:(1)1.考虑分页的回显问题 2.考虑分页后勾选的保存问题
 
  解决方案:1 根据 关联表 用户id与表单展示实际用户进行比较 进行回显
                    2 使用js 技术 保留 每一页勾选 统一提交后台  保存
                    3 后台获取选择的数据 现将该分组所有数据删除 然后添加

  问题:(2)1 不考虑分页 要求A组选择数据其他组不能选择 2回显问题分本组变灰 
      
   解决方案:1 建立第一分组时 先获取关联表数据:if null 则全部显示
                     2 当分组大于1  查询该医院分组表

                            if 组id ==当前组Id 可以选择
                            else 变成灰色不能勾选

                       3 后台获取选择的数据 现将该分组所有数据删除 然后添加

 

 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值